Heating element corroded, not heating
Removed bottom plate and heating element brass nuts. Disconnected heating element. Connected new one then replaced brass nuts. Put bottom plate back on. Very easy.
1. Bottom door gasket removed very easy by grabbing left corning and pulling out. Starting with notch on right side, slide the hard plastic side up at a slight angle to catch the slot the gasket will seat in. Slowly moving toward the left, push gasket into seated position. Notch in gasket will make sure it is in correct position. Push gasket all the way in so that it is flush with bottom edge of door. Watch when first sliding gasket in, it has to g at a slight up angle or it will fall into an empty space. 2. Remove Tub gasket by gripping one side and pulling out. Replace in same fashion making sure the angled wedge of gasket is first part that lays flat in slot. Working from one side to the other, make sure the gasket seats completely. Trim excess if necessary.
I will make a few additions to the other instructions, which are great and let me see that the job was doable. To the tools needed, add pipe tape. 1. Shut off water supply. 2. Removed inlet water hose where it connects to the valve assembly. (This was a pain on my machine—too little room for the wrench, you may have a better tool—but I did get it out, slowly.) 3. Removed the two bracket screws holding the assembly to the frame, and detached the electrical connection (Look for your red and blue wires on the connector, my red was to the top of the solenoid, and reattach with the same grounding) from the solenoid. (This step was a great bit of information; It allowed me to see that I could do the following steps with ease, That is, the unit dropped down where you could work on it.) 4. Removed the inlet hose adapter connection from old valve and installed into new valve. 5. Attached electrical connection to new valve solenoid. 6. Remounted assembly to the frame. 7. Re-attached the inlet water hose to the hose adapter connection on the valve. (I had to take off the L shaped connector at the bottom of the old valve and add it to the new valve. This was an extra step that required two bigger wrenches to hold the old assembly and unscrew the L joint. I just needed the extra leverage to get the old off and the new on. I am referring to the copper connection that connects to you water supply) (8) The new valve had a slightly different configuration than my old. The rack it sits on was about an inch or so longer. This meant that I had to readjust my copper pipe just a bit to match up when it was reassembled. No big deal, I had lots of pipe length to work with. Actually, moving the valve a bit further back made more room for the wrench to work—very happy about that. In addition, the hose attachment went from a left exit to a back exit. Doesn’t seem to matter. (9) Turned on the water, washed some dishes. (Took me about an hour, mostly because of the difficulty with the wrenches. Otherwise—piece of cake)

After figuring out the problem wasn't the water inlet switch, I replaced the switch assembly for the water level float. Cut off supply water to dishwasher, removed the 2 screws holding switch assembly, and installed new switch. 15 minutes, very easy job.
Dishwasher was leaking at the lower left side of the door.
Probably the easiest repair job that you could encounter. I removed the old gasket from the door frame. Cut the new gasket to length and pushed it into the door frame.
Removed the bottom panel on the unit (2 screws hold it on) and pulled the dishwasher out about 4"--after turning off electricity to the unit. Removed the broken spring and the old linkage and replaced them with the new parts. Pushed the diswasher back into place, and replaced the bottom panel. Turned on the electricity and the diswasher door is "good as new." This is quite simple to do; just takes patience.
One of the springs was broken, The door would not open or close properly. There was also a leak coming from the front of the dishwasher.
I removed the dishwasher from the cabinet space (two screws) and manually replaced both springs. I replaced one spring first to see if there would be an improvement when the second new spring was installed. There was much better tension once the second new spring was added.That is why changing both springs is recommended. This was very easy. Unscrewed dishwasher from cabinet and pulled out about 1 foot. Took bottom plate off of dishwasher. Undid clamp on hose of discharge of inlet water valve and removed hose. Shut off water to water inlet valve and removed. Took wiring clip off of water inlet valve. Removed 2 screws holding water inlet valve in place. Installed new water inlet valve in reverse order.
Fully open dishwasher door to horizontal position, remove lower dishwasher rack and relocate to another temp location, grab old lower door seal from right or left corner and pull completely out of door, lay the old bottom seal aside facing the same direction as once installed (seal has a notched side which faces the right side of door), match direction of the new seal with the old seal (match the notched side of seal to the right side of door), gently push the seal into the door starting on the right side (notched side of seal fits tightly into a receiving area inside the door), and finally push the remaining portion of the seal into door (aligning with the right side already properly seated inside dishwasher door). Close dishwasher and run water cycle to confirm leak.
Pulled the dishwasher out and laid it on its back. From under the dishwasher I unscrewed three screws and freed the drain pump from some sort of frame. Then with the pliers loosed the orange clamp that held the black hose to it. Then unscrewed the clamp that held the white hose to it. Then pulled out the purple and white fuse wires. These wires were very tight I used pliers to get them off. The pump was free. Be sure to have a bowl to catch all the water. There wasn't a lot but it stinks. Then put it all together the way I took it apart. The dishwasher works perfectly now.
